Key Insights
- Evaluating factual accuracy is critical for developers using generative AI models.
- Designing effective measure frameworks can mitigate hallucination risks in outputs.
- Understanding data provenance is crucial for maintaining compliance and avoiding copyright issues.
- Real-world applications of generative AI will increasingly rely on evaluating model performance across contexts.
- Developers must navigate safety concerns, particularly regarding misuse and bias in generated content.
Assessing Accuracy in Generative AI: Developer Considerations
The rapid evolution of generative AI technologies has amplified the need for developers to rigorously evaluate the factuality of their outputs. Tools and applications leveraging artificial intelligence are permeating various sectors—such as content creation, customer service, and academic research—requiring enhanced scrutiny of the generated results. In the context of “Evaluating Factuality in Generative AI: Implications for Developers,” understanding how to assess and improve the reliability of these systems has become imperative for multiple stakeholders, including solo entrepreneurs, visual artists, and independent professionals. Specific use cases, such as incorporating AI-generated content in marketing materials or streamlining study aids, showcase real-world implications where factual accuracy is pivotal. As developers refine their tools, they are influenced by models’ performance metrics, configurations, and the broader ecosystem’s regulatory frameworks, which further complicate the deployment landscape.
Why This Matters
The Core of Generative AI Capabilities
Generative AI encompasses a wide array of technologies capable of producing text, images, audio, and more. Central to these capabilities are deep learning architectures, particularly transformers, which enable models to generate coherent outputs based on input prompts. Developers must understand how foundational models are trained using vast datasets, which serve as the basis for output generation. This training process is crucial for ensuring that the generated content aligns with user expectations while minimizing discrepancies.
Emerging models are often fine-tuned to specific tasks or domains through techniques like reinforcement learning from human feedback (RLHF). Knowing how the underlying architecture functions can aid developers in diagnosing potential pitfalls related to factual validation.
Evidence and Performance Evaluation
Measuring the performance of generative AI systems involves assessing multiple factors, including quality, fidelity, and biases. Evaluative frameworks can include user studies, benchmark tests, and algorithmic assessments to scrutinize outputs. Quality regression and hallucinations—occurrences where models produce inaccurate or nonsensical outputs—pose significant challenges for developers aiming for high integrity in their applications.
Robust testing protocols can help identify model weaknesses before deployment, especially in mission-critical applications such as healthcare or legal services, where inaccuracies may lead to severe consequences.
Data Provenance and Ethical Considerations
Understanding the origins of training data is crucial for developers to ensure compliance with copyright and licensing regulations. The risk of utilizing data without proper authorization can jeopardize a project’s legality, exposing developers to legal issues and reputational risks. Moreover, issues related to style imitation and the risk of derivative work further complicate the landscape.
Developers should also implement signal provenance techniques, such as watermarking, as a means to track data usage and prevent unauthorized replication within generative outputs, thereby fortifying ethical practices.
Safety and Security Risks
Generative AI models pose various safety and security risks, including prompt injection attacks, content moderation failures, and potential for biased output generation. Developers must prioritize robust content moderation protocols and adopt multi-layered security mechanisms to mitigate these risks. Ongoing monitoring of model performance in real-world scenarios can further address vulnerabilities and response strategies related to misuse.
Addressing these concerns is crucial, particularly as AI systems become increasingly integrated into daily applications utilized by creators, freelancers, and educators.
Deployment Challenges and Reality
The deployment of generative AI systems is laden with challenges related to inference costs, rate limits, and context handling. Developers must balance computational efficiency with output quality, often encountering latency issues that can affect user experience. Practical performance metrics are essential for achieving optimal outcomes, and diligent evaluation of context limits is crucial for refining generative tasks.
Furthermore, understanding the trade-offs between on-device versus cloud-based solutions will inform strategic deployment decisions, emphasizing the need for scalable and adaptable architectures tailored to specific use cases.
Practical Applications Across Domains
Generative AI has diverse applications that span both technical and non-technical domains. Developers building applications for API access must consider orchestration features, which enhance observability and facilitate retrieval quality. In parallel, non-technical operators, such as small business owners and students, can benefit from AI’s capabilities in content production, customer support, and study aids.
For instance, a freelancer could leverage generative AI to draft proposals or create marketing copy, while a student might employ it as a study aid for summarizing complex topics. The integration of AI-generated content can streamline workflows significantly while raising essential questions regarding the evaluation of factual integrity and originality.
Trade-offs and Risks in Generative AI Implementation
There are numerous considerations and risks tied to implementing generative AI, from potential quality regressions to hidden costs related to infrastructure. Compliance failures can also result in serious implications, making vigilance crucial for developers. The risk of dataset contamination is another significant concern, which can undermine the reliability of outputs by introducing biases inherent in training data.
Monitoring and mitigating these risks should be an ongoing priority for developers, as they navigate the rapid changes in the generative AI landscape.
Market Context and Ecosystem Dynamics
The generative AI market is characterized by the tension between open and closed models, each with its set of advantages and challenges. Open-source tools may provide greater flexibility and adaptability for developers, but they can also come with additional complexities related to security and compliance. Conversely, proprietary models often offer streamlined integration but can impose heavy vendor lock-in.
Engagement with standards and initiatives such as NIST’s AI Risk Management Framework and ISO/IEC guidelines can inform best practices and promote responsible usage frameworks across the development community. These frameworks encourage developers to adopt transparent evaluation strategies and prioritize ethical considerations in their generative AI applications.
What Comes Next
- Monitor trends in generative AI evaluation frameworks and adapt compliance mechanisms accordingly.
- Conduct pilot tests focusing on the reduction of hallucinations in output content.
- Explore collaborations with regulatory bodies to enhance data provenance and ethical use strategies.
- Experiment with different deployment settings to identify optimal configurations for real-world applications.
Sources
- NIST AI Risk Management Framework ✔ Verified
- AI and Ethics: A 2021 Survey ● Derived
- ISO/IEC Standards on AI Management ○ Assumption
